Not Much Hyperventilating Over Hacker’s Hypervisor Code Theft

May 1, 2012 Author: Category: Greg's Blog

A hacker with the handle "Hardcore Charlie" has stolen source code for VMware's ESX hypervisor and posted it on the Internet. A hypervisor provides a virtualization layer between operating systems and the underlying hardware, creating … View full post on National Cyber Security » Computer Hacking
